Clarksville Christmas Lights: The Ultimate Guide to Holiday Magic

Clarksville Christmas lights transform the town into a glowing winter wonderland each holiday season. Residents and visitors stroll beneath shimmering displays while festive music fills the crisp air.

This guide highlights the best spots, timing tips, and traditions that make Clarksville’s holiday illumination special. You will find curated routes, family activities, and practical details to plan your visit.

Route Name Key Neighborhoods Peak Display Dates Parking Tips
Downtown Riverwalk Front Street, Public Square November 20 – January 5 Use Riverfront Garage, arrive before 6 PM
Greenwood Heights Greenwood Avenue, Lincoln Street December 1 – January 2 Park at Greenwood Church, walk two blocks
Liberty Park Loop Liberty Park, Residential side streets December 10 – December 31 Metered spots available, limit 2 hours
East College Corridor College Street, Riverside Drive November 28 – January 6 Free lots at campus edges, shuttle on weekends

Best Times to See Clarksville Christmas Lights

Weeknight vs Weekend Displays

Weeknights offer a calmer experience with fewer crowds, while weekends feature extended hours and live music near major displays. For photos without bustle, aim for Tuesday or Wednesday evenings.

Weather and Lighting Schedule

Clear evenings in early December provide optimal viewing before holiday events increase foot traffic. Check the city calendar for lighting ceremony dates and special turn-off times to avoid disappointment.

Family Friendly Holiday Activities

Lighted Trail Walks and Story Stops

Families can follow a mapped trail that connects decorated homes, church displays, and public installations with short narration stops for children. Bring a thermos of hot cocoa for a cozy break midway.

Photo Opportunities and Scavenger Hunts

Designated photo zones with holiday props appear near the riverfront and in town squares. Printable scavenger hunts engage younger kids as they search for themed figures hidden in the displays.

Decorating Your Home for Clarksville Christmas Lights

Safe Installation and Energy Efficiency

Use UL-rated extension cords, anchor displays securely, and avoid overloading outdoor outlets. Consider LED strings to lower energy use and ensure consistent brightness across long runs.

Local Guidelines and Community Coordination

Check homeowners association rules and city ordinances regarding height, wiring, and disposal timing. Coordinating with neighbors can create unified themes that enhance entire streets.

Community Traditions and Events

Parades, Carol Nights, and Civic Switching Ceremonies

Annual parades feature floats, marching bands, and visiting choirs that weave through decorated streets. Carol nights invite community singers to gather in parks while city officials flip holiday switches.

Volunteer Opportunities and Nonprofit Partnerships

Local nonprofits coordinate donation drives, tree lighting spotters, and cleanup crews after major events. Volunteering offers residents a chance to shape the holiday atmosphere while meeting neighbors.

Planning Your Clarksville Holiday Lighting Visit

  • Review the city map and highlight priority routes based on your family’s interests.
  • Check the published schedule for lighting ceremonies and special event nights.
  • Arrive early at popular zones to secure convenient parking and shorter walk times.
  • Bring layered clothing, comfortable shoes, and a camera with fully charged batteries.
  • Support local vendors at holiday markets along the main routes.
  • Respect private property and follow posted guidance for photography and pets.

FAQ

Reader questions

Where is the best place to park when visiting the Clarksville Christmas lights downtown?

The Riverfront Garage at 200 Riverfront Plaza is the most convenient option for the Downtown Riverwalk display, with elevator access and staff on duty until 10 PM.

Are pets allowed at the major holiday light displays in Clarksville?

Leashed pets are generally welcome on public sidewalks and riverwalk paths, but they are not permitted inside enclosed event tents or interactive installations.

What is the typical peak season for Clarksville Christmas lights to be at their brightest?

Display intensity is highest from mid December through New Year’s Day, when many neighborhoods keep lights on until 10 PM on most evenings.

Do neighborhoods coordinate themes or accept donations for lighting displays?

Some streets organize shared themes and accept modest donations for wiring or extension cords, while others manage displays independently through resident volunteers.
